Verdict

KNOCKROBIN probably wasn’t winning out of turn at Catterick and should be able to give the weight away to thus bunch, despite 4lb rise. De Forgotten One blotted his copybook when pulled up at Wetherby but this looks a bit easier. Jaboticaba has finished second three times over fences but was unplaced last time at Kempton and Monsieur D'Arque probably needs a bit more and some help from the handicapper.
